Corkscrew Rush and False Aralia Physical Information
Corkscrew Rush and False Aralia physical information is very important for comparison. Corkscrew Rush height is 45.70 cm and width 61.00 cm whereas False Aralia height is 760.00 cm and width 300.00 cm. The color specification of Corkscrew Rush and False Aralia are as follows:
Corkscrew Rush flower color: Brown
Corkscrew Rush leaf color: Green
False Aralia flower color: Yellow, Red and Green
- False Aralia leaf color: Red, Green, Dark Green and Brown
